In energetic language, these are ten movies that inspire and provoke your the second, or sacral Chakra. Try to watch any of them from your “guts”, if you wish to use them to resolve issues related to your primal connection with life’s experience.

  1. The Doors (1991, Oliver Stone) – The bigger-than-life story of musician Jim Morrison, where art, psychedelic drugs, mystical experiences, unrestrained sexuality, totality of expression and alcohol addiction are inseparably entwined.
  2. The Pillow Book (1996, Director: Peter Greenaway) – A unique, poetic and visually-stunning journey into the human body as a work of art.
  3. Life is beautiful (1997, Director: Roberto Benigni) – A most unexpected Holocaust comedy, showing how the joy of life can win even under the harshest conditions imaginable.
  4. Chocolat (2000, Director: Lasse Hallstrom) – A mysterious chocolate maker unsettles the tranquil life of a conservative French town.
  5. Into The Wild (2007, Sean Penn) – A young man embarking on a dangerous adventure into the Alaskan wilderness, leaving everything behind for the sake of total experience.
  6. Where the wild things are (2009, Director: Spike Jonze) – Mischievous little Max unleashes the wild monsters of his subconscious and becomes their leader.
  7. Life of Pi (2012, Director: Ang Lee) – Young Pi finds himself lost in the Pacific ocean, sharing one lifeboat with a fierce Bengal tiger and a breathtaking journey into life’s mysteries and beauty.
  8. Begin again (2013, Director: John Carney) – A romantically abandoned unknown musician stumbles across a failed music producer, finding with him the joy of pure creativity and passion for life and music.
  9. Inside Out (2015, Directors: Pete Docter, Ronnie Del Carmen) – 11-year old Riley has her world turned upside-down when leaving her world of sweet childhood behind. Her internal world needs to come to terms with the loss of joy as she knew it.
  10. The little prince (2015, Director: Mark Osborne) – An aviator introduces a girl to a world where she discovers what it means to be a child at heart forever.
